Fantastic Frames!









It seems like everyone is looking for ways to cut down on energy costs. I have noticed a lot of folks are replacing their old wooden window frames with energy efficient windows. There are ways to reuse those old wooden window frames. Here are a couple of unique ideas that I found very interesting:

Coffee table top. The windows may no longer stop a draft, but if they are the right size you could add a few legs and you got a table. Who needs coasters for those hot drinks… you can put them directly on the glass!





And my favorite …
Greenhouse: Using bricks or other objects, raise windows off the ground and put plants that need a little extra protection from the elements underneath. This can be especially useful for some seedlings that you started inside and are ready for the outdoors but need more transition time before being transplanted to the garden.
